7. Business model of xiaomi
• Xiaomi employs a strategy that is very
unlike other smart phone makers such as
Samsung and Apple
• The company prices the phone almost at
bill-of-material prices
• Xiaomi does not own a single physical
store and instead sells exclusively from its
own online store
• Away with traditional advertising
• The Xiaomi products are manufactured by
Foxconn and Inventec.( outsourcing the
electronic component production)
• Use of social networking services as well
as its own customers to help advertise its
products
• Focus on hardware,software,Network
services and online sales
8. • Xiaomi has maintained close cooperation with
Taiwan-based manufacturers
• Xiaomi has relied heavily on Taiwanese
suppliers including Inventec and Hon Hai for
assembly, Wintek and TPK for screen
technology, and Unimicron for PCB (printed
circuit boards), as well as Taiwan
Semiconductor Manufacturing Corp (TSMC)
for processors.
• Other electronic component are imported
from countries nearby such as MOS &battery
from Thailand, screen from sharp, camera
from Sony, flash light from Philips
9. • Excellent forecasting technique, by open an
online registration window on e commerce
websites,
• Based on registration estimates the actual
demand of mobile sets
• Always produce less against demand its hunger
marketing strategy,
• After demand forecasting place order to
suppliers for component
• Components shipped to Shenzhen port near to
hongkong and assembled in local foundry.
• There is no surplus raw material to be managed.
10. • As every phone has its owner so they use cross docking at ware house
one team receive delivery and double check and second team pack the
phones with accessories and attaché the order to the package and
deliver it to the user. it saves 80% inventory cost in warehouse
• Outsource phone manufacturing and assembly process to foundry.
• Assembled phones are delivered to warehouses across china with FTL
• Cross Docking
11. • Reduce cost of shipping by establish its warehouse
near to ecommerce companies warehouse
• Establish cooperation with e commerce companies in
warehouse management and shipping,
• By cooperation take advantage of e commerce
companies delivery system and ensure the product
can reach to the user faster.
12. Value creation through Guru mantras
• Savings by use guru mantras of
supply chain
• By eliminating distributer & retailer
saves around 60%
• 80% saving in warehouse
management;20% cost incurred on
battery accessories &packaging
materials
• 4 to 5% saving in advertising cost,
spend only 1% of revenue on
advertising
• zero inventory carrying cost for raw
materials
• Significant savings by outsourcing
the manufacturing and assembling
